Torres linked with Blues

According to the Daily Mail, Chelsea are keeping tabs on Villarreal centre-back Pau Torres, who has been linked with a number of other big European clubs.

The young defender has impressed as a regular starter for Villarreal, who are currently fifth in La Liga, and made his senior debut for Spain last November.

‘Torres, the 23-year-old central defender, has been attracting interest across the continent after impressing during his first full season in La Liga,’ states the report.

‘A host of clubs – including the Manchester sides, Arsenal and Barcelona – have been linked with a move ahead of the summer transfer window.

‘Torres has a release clause of around £45million in his contract, which still has three years left to run.’

Ballack feels Werner made wise choice

Former Chelsea midfielder Michael Ballack has said Timo Werner made the right decision to join the Blues, believing he will have a big impact at Stamford Bridge, the Evening Standard reports.

Werner is set to join the Blues next season after a prolific spell at RB Leipzig and Ballack feels his German compatriot will be a good fit in Frank Lampard’s side.

‘If Liverpool was really an option for him, he made the best decision for him, and only he can make that decision,’ Ballack told the i.

‘You have to value certain things, like how much playing time you will get and how important a role in the squad you will have.

‘Chelsea are building a young team, a new team, with a young coach. It is a great project to be part of, given how young Timo is.

‘To be the main striker, at a huge club like Chelsea, is the best place for him. He can have a much bigger impact than he could at Liverpool.’

Mikel to join Baggies?

Sky Sports reports former Blues midfielder John Mikel Obi could be returning to English football at West Bromwich Albion.

The 33-year-old has been without a club since he left Turkish side Trabzonspor by mutual consent in March.

However, the report by the broadcasters suggests the Nigerian could soon be back in top flight with the Baggies.

‘West Brom are understood to be one of a number of clubs exploring the option of signing Mikel on a free transfer,’ states the report.

‘The Baggies are currently second in the Championship and look well placed to secure a return to the Premier League following a two-season absence from the top flight.

‘Mikel enjoyed a trophy-laden 11 years at Chelsea earlier in his career, winning the Premier League, FA Cup, Champions League and Europa League.

‘He also had a brief spell with Middlesbrough in the Championship during the 2018/19 campaign, featuring 19 times, scoring once.’
